"Communicating successfully is the final goal of mastering a foreign language." From the syllabus to the textbooks, from the teaching method to the way of learning, it is clear that speaking is more and more stressed nowadays.Testing has a great effect both to teaching and learning. " How to test, how to teach and how to learn." Yet there is no oral English test in the high middle school .especially in the NMET. The present paper discusses the language ability of the high middle school students according to Bachman's communicative language ability theory, That is grammatical competence .vocabularies , sounds and textual competence .The effective way to measure such competence should include both objective items and subjective items .Therefore oral testing should be added in order to meet the requirement of reliability and validity of English test in high middle school.How to test oral English effectively in the high middle school is the present paper concerned. According to Bachman's communicative language ability theory, combining other relevant research such as Zhu Chun's different levels theory, the paper points out that language ability of high middle school students should emphasize the organizational competence rather than pragmatic competence. We have designed an experiment to know the Reliability and Validity of our test. The subjects involved were 100 high school students. They are all volunteered to attend English oral test. Our oral test consists of two parts: reading aloud and role playing. There are two raters giving scores. The average of the two raters is the final score of the individual .The results of the two raters were compared with the final results of our school written paper held in the end of the school term. They were all inputted into the computer, a statistical analysis system (SPSS 11.5) was used to analyze them. The findings are summarized as follows:We used Bachman's reliability and validity theories to get the relevant coefficients to evaluate the oral test The reliability and the validity of this oral test are positive .The test is practical.
